3. Data Storage
Your data is stored exclusively on your device using Android’s local database (Room), local files, and DataStore. We do not operate any backend server and do not transmit your data to any server owned or operated by TESTIQ LLC. Because there is no cloud copy, backup is disabled — uninstalling the App removes its data from your device.
Data on your device is protected by the Android application sandbox. It is not encrypted by the App beyond the protection provided by your device. We strongly recommend you keep a screen lock and device encryption enabled.
4. When Data Leaves Your Device
Your information leaves your device only in these cases, and only to the third party you are asking the App to reach:
- Fetching a bill. When you add or refresh a bill, the App sends the reference or account details you entered to the selected provider’s website or billing portal (for example the PITC bill portal, K-Electric, SNGPL, SSGC, WASA, or PTCL) so it can return your bill.
- Load-shedding lookup. For supported electricity accounts, the App sends your reference number to the official CCMS load-shedding service to retrieve the outage schedule for your feeder.
- In-app review. If you choose to rate the App, Google Play’s in-app review service is used; any data it handles is governed by Google’s privacy policy.
These provider and government systems are not owned or controlled by TESTIQ LLC and have their own privacy practices, availability, and accuracy limits.

6. Analytics, Tracking and Ads
This version of SabBill contains no analytics SDKs, advertising frameworks, or third-party tracking libraries. On-device text recognition (used to detect a “paid” stamp on some bills) runs entirely on your device using Google ML Kit; no images are sent off your device.
If a future version introduces advertising, analytics, cloud backup, accounts, or payments, this Privacy Policy and the Google Play Data Safety section will be updated before that version is released.
